    NBA Teams Embrace Full Court Press At Historic Rate

    NBA teams are deploying full-court pressure defense at unprecedented levels this season, pressing on 4.8% of possessions through the first week. The dramatic increase nearly quintuples the 1% rate from a decade ago and nearly doubles the 2.5% from two seasons ago, according to Yahoo Sports.

    The trend follows the aggressive defensive approach utilized by the Indiana Pacers during their NBA Finals run against the Oklahoma City Thunder. The Thunder responded by pressing the Pacers at higher rates than usual, prompting teams league-wide to adopt similar tactics.

    The Portland Trail Blazers lead the NBA with a 24.5% press rate and an 81.7 defensive rating on those possessions. The Blazers frequently swarm ball-handlers immediately after made baskets, forcing turnovers and rushed offensive sets.

    The Blazers, Boston Celtics, Toronto Raptors and Pacers are the only teams pressing on over 10% of defensive possessions. These rosters feature either defensive-oriented veterans or young, cost-effective players seeking to establish themselves.

    The strategy doesn’t require elite talent or significant spending, making it accessible across different roster constructions. Teams are compensating for the physical demands by implementing quicker substitutions and deeper rotation patterns. Portland has utilized platoon-style substitutions, swapping four or five players simultaneously.

    The Cleveland Cavaliers have also increased their press frequency from 2.5 plays per game last season to 7.8 times per game. The Cavaliers often use the tactic to steer the ball away from primary creators rather than solely forcing turnovers.

    Full-court pressure steals six-to-eight seconds off the shot clock, forcing opponents into late-clock offensive sets. The approach also disrupts rhythm and wears down explosive shot creators physically and mentally.

    Daryl Morey predicted increased full-court pressure in 2016, though the trend took seven years to materialize. The Finals runs by Indiana and Oklahoma City demonstrated the tactic’s effectiveness at the highest level.
